Overview

LMI is a consultancy dedicated to powering a future-ready, high-performing government, drawing from expertise in digital and analytic solutions, logistics, and management advisory services. We deliver integrated capabilities that incorporate emerging technologies and are tailored to customers' unique mission needs, backed by objective research and data analysis. Founded in 1961 to help the Department of Defense resolve complex logistics management challenges, LMI continues to enable growth and transformation, enhance operational readiness and resiliency, and ensure mission success for federal civilian and defense agencies.

LMI is seeking a Senior Data Scientist to support an Intelligence Community client. This position will be located in the Northern VA area.

Responsibilities
    Coordinate requirements directly with the Sponsor and internal subject matter experts
  • Demonstrate the ability to frame and scale data problems to analyze, visualize, and find data solutions.

  • Manipulate common data formats, including comma-delimited, text files, and JSON.

  • Transform data and analysis into informative visualizations and interactive dashboards using open-source and commercially available tools.

  • Derive insights and analytic narratives from data and visualizations for effective storytelling and clear communication in response to client research questions.

  • Work in a fast-paced, solutions-oriented environment focused on client deliverables, analysis, and reporting.

Qualifications
  • Active TS/SCI clearance with Polygraph
  • Bachelors in STEM or related
  • 5+ years of data science, data engineering, or data management experience
  • Working knowledge of individual, organizational, technological, or transnational issues of national security concern
  • Prior experience with the Intelligence Community and methodological experience in some of the following areas: relationships and discovery (correlating, enriching and prioritizing data about activity among actors, devices or facilities to enable the discovery of structure, roles, key relationships and targets), situational awareness (unifying data into a single context, allowing the current situation to be accurately and quickly understood), systems modeling (building a computational analog of a real-world system - political, military, economic, social or technical - to understand how it operates, what it is capable of, and how it may react to shocks) and business analytics (supporting data-driven decisions about how we can improve the business of intelligence).
  • Working knowledge of appropriate analytic methods and methodological tools in two or more (Senior)/all three (Expert) of the following areas:
    • Applied mathematics (e.g. probability and statistics, multivariable calculus, linear algebra, ordinary and partial differential equations, stochastic processes, graph theory)
    • Computer programming (e.g., scripting, data parsing/ETL, artificial intelligence, machine learning, math/statistics packages, natural language processing, software versioning, distributed computing)
    • Visualization (e.g., dashboard creation, network analysis, GIS/geospatial analysis, telemetry analysis)
  • Working knowledge of Python and some of the following software/tools: SQL, R, Hadoop, Spark, Java, C/C++, Git, Bash, Tableau, ArcGIS, Unix commands
  • Working knowledge of research designs
  • Working knowledge of collection methods, capabilities, and tasking process
  • Familiarity with project management concepts and principles
  • Intellectual curiosity; creativity and innovation to go beyond current tools to deliver the best solution to complex problems
  • Strong analytical and critical thinking skills
  • Ability to leverage multiple data management tools to organize relevant information and make decisions
  • Ability to develop comprehensive software applications, as needed
  • Ability to translate complex, technical findings into an easily understood narrative (i.e., tell a story with the data) in graphical, verbal, or written form
  • Ability to multitask and change focus quickly as demands change
  • Ability work collaboratively and effectively in a team environment
  • Ability to establish and maintain internal and external professional networks including subject matter experts, collectors, and decision makers that are necessary to carry out tasks or projects
